Another form of free promotion is to get links to your website from other sites around the Internet.  In my opinion the following examples of website promotion are the best ways to obtain an increase in traffic to your website.  If you are trying to gain extra traffic to your website, looking to increase your search engine position or hoping to increase your page rank, it is a must to increase the amount of backward links you have.

If you are looking to increase your search engine position it is a good idea to try to increase the amount of backward links you have.  Writing articles is a great way to generate incoming links to your Website, and the results can increase daily if you just keep up with it.  As your list of published articles grows larger, and more and more of your articles appear on different Websites, the cumulative total of links to your own Website increases.
